2012-13 Rockford IceHogs: Where Did They Come From?

As the NHL and the NHLPA continue leaving fans at home, the AHL season is about to begin. The Blackhawks’ AHL affiliate in Rockford has an impressive roster with a handful of young players with NHL experience.

Now two full seasons removed from the Stanley Cup victory (and subsequent break-up), it’s worth looking at this year’s Rockford roster to see how it’s been impacted by various trades over the last couple years.

  • Forwards
    Kyle Beach – 2008 Draft – 1st rnd (#11)
    Brandon Bollig free agent signing (2010)
    Rob Flick – 2010 Draft – 4th rnd (#120)
    Jimmy Hayes acquired from Toronto for Calgary’s 2010 2nd rnd pick
    – traded pick acquired from Calgary for Rene Bourque
    Marcus Kruger – 2009 Draft – 5th rnd (#149)
    Peter LeBlanc – 2006 Draft – 7th rnd (#186)
    Jeremy Morin – acquired from Atlanta with Marty Reasoner, Joey Crabb and New Jersey’s 1st and 2nd round picks in 2010 (acq. by ATL in Ilya Kovalchuk trade) – #26 (F Kevin Hayes) and #54 (D Justin Holl)  for Dustin Byfuglien, Ben Eager, Brent Sopel and Akim Aliu
    Philippe Paradis – acquired from Toronto with Viktor Stalberg and Chris DiDomenico for Kris Versteeg and Billy Sweatt.
    Brandon Pirri – 2009 Draft – 2nd rnd (#59)
    Brandon Saad – 2011 Draft – 2nd rnd (#43)
    – pick acquired with Toronto’s 2011 3rd round pick (#70 – D Michael Paliotta) from Calgary thru Toronto for Toronto’s 2010 2nd rnd pick. Chicago acquired Toronto’s pick from Montreal for Robert Lang
    Andrew Shaw –  2011 Draft – 5th rnd (#139)
    Ben Smith – 2008 Draft – 6th rnd (#169)
    – pick acquired from Ottawa for Martin LaPointe
  • Defensemen
    Adam Clendening
    – 2011 Draft – 2nd rnd (#36)
    – pick acquired with Ivan Vishnevskiy from Atlanta for Andrew Ladd
    Klas Dahlbeck – 2011 Draft – 2nd rnd (#79)
    Shawn Lalonde – 2008 Draft – 2nd rnd (#68)
    Joe Lavin – 2007 Draft – 5th rnd (#126)
    Nick Leddy – acquired from Minnesota with Kim Johnsson for Cam Barker
    Dylan Olsen – 2009 Draft – 1st rnd (#28)
    Ryan Stanton – free agent signing (2010)
  • Goaltenders
    Carter Hutton
    – free agent signing (2012)
    Alec Richards – free agent signing (2009)

Forwards Martin St. Pierre, Wade Brookbank and Brandon Svendsen and defensemen Ben Youds and Brett Lebda are playing on AHL contracts.

As you can see, only 10 of the 26 players on the Rockford roster were drafted by the Blackhawks with picks that were originally property of the Chicago organization.
